A person from Northern Ireland who was once struck by means of a automotive at a Liverpool Football Club parade has mentioned his first idea was once looking for his female friend.

Jack Trotter, from Newtownards, County Down, and his female friend Abbie Gallagher had been hit by means of the auto because it drove into enthusiasts on Water Street, in Liverpool.

It took place at about 18:00 BST on Monday as hundreds of Liverpool FC enthusiasts accumulated within the town centre for the Premier League victory parade.

“The first thought that I got was: ‘Where’s Abbie? I need to find Abbie. Where’s Abbie?’ You know she could be anywhere at this rate and lucky enough she was screaming my name and I found her,” Mr Trotter informed the BBC.
